R. L. Hall is a scholar working on Molecular Biology, Pulmonary and Respiratory Medicine and Genetics. According to data from OpenAlex, R. L. Hall has authored 21 papers receiving a total of 351 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Molecular Biology, 4 papers in Pulmonary and Respiratory Medicine and 4 papers in Genetics. Recurrent topics in R. L. Hall's work include Glycosylation and Glycoproteins Research (8 papers), Proteoglycans and glycosaminoglycans research (3 papers) and Virus-based gene therapy research (3 papers). R. L. Hall is often cited by papers focused on Glycosylation and Glycoproteins Research (8 papers), Proteoglycans and glycosaminoglycans research (3 papers) and Virus-based gene therapy research (3 papers). R. L. Hall collaborates with scholars based in United Kingdom, United States and France. R. L. Hall's co-authors include P S Richardson, Edward J. Wood, A. C. Peatfield, Roger Phipps, I P Williams, R K Craig, Irvin A. Lampert, S. P. Snyder, Dennis W. Macy and Gerrit J. Gerwig and has published in prestigious journals such as Biochemical Journal, Biochimica et Biophysica Acta (BBA) - Molecular Cell Research and American Journal of Respiratory Cell and Molecular Biology.
